Ramallah : Israeli soldiers stormed into the West Bank in a major operation that ended at dawn on Monday, arresting 30 Palestinians.
The incursion mainly targeted the refugee camps of Al Ein and Balata, in Naplusa, where the Israeli forces detained 29 alleged members of the Palestinian resistance, said eyewitnesses and local sources.
The Israeli military command confirmed the information.
Meanwhile in a contradictory version, some sources announced the lifting of the Israeli blockade on the West Bank, while others confirmed that it remains.
This severe measure was adopted by Tel Aviv after the Thursday attack against an Israeli religious school in Kyriat Mosher neigborhood, in Jerusalem, where at least eight persons were killed and another 35 were wounded.
Also Thursday, the Palestine Liberation Organization called the decision of Israel to build 700 houses in the West Bank region of Givat Zeet a provocation.
A report from the Palestinian head negotiator, Saeb Erekat, says that the measure reinforces the intention of the Israeli authorities to strengthen even more their illegal occupation and colonization of Palestinian territory.
